WebbPerson Administering Scale _____ Administer stroke scale items in the order listed. Record performance in each category after each subscale exam. Do not go back and change scores. Follow directions provided for each exam technique. Scores should reflect what the patient does, not what the clinician thinks the patient can do. WebbNIH Stroke Scale Training DVD.
